Pancakes are American's oothappam ;-) small round fluffy dosa. They are really yummy. Usually people have pancakes with honey and butter. You can try with your favorite sauces too. They are tasty and very simple to prepare.

As a variation, you can add fruit slices (Banana, Blueberry, Strawberry etc.) or essence(Vanilla, Strawberry etc.) to the batter to make it more delicious and healthy.

Preparation time : 10 min
Cooking time : 5 min
Serves : 2
Ingredients:

All purpose flour / maida - 1 cup
Egg - 2
Milk - 1 1/2 cup
Vinegar - 2tbsp
Butter - 1 tbsp
Sugar - 4 tbsp
Salt - 1/2 tsp
Baking soda - 1/2 tsp
Baking powder - 1 tsp

Procedure:

  1.   In a bowl pour milk and add vinegar. Keep it for 3-4 min. Milk will turn sour.
  2.   In  another mixing bowl, add all purpose flour sugar salt baking soda and baking powder. Mix them well and set aside.
  3.    Melt the butter. I kept the butter in microwave for 30 sec.
  4.   In a mixer, break and pour the raw eggs. Add melted butter to the mixer. Run the mixer for few sec.
  5.   Add sour milk to the mixer. Blend them again for 3-5 sec.
  6.   Finally add all purpose flour mix into the mixer and blend them for 5-7 sec till it becomes soft batter
  7.   Heat dosa pan or griddle and grease it will cooking oil. Keep the stove in medium flame. 
  8.   Take a scoop of batter and pour them in the pan like little oothappam.
  9.   When one side is cooked well, turn to the other side.
  10.  These pancake tastes great when hot, with butter. You can have it with honey too.
Note 
  • Alternatively, the mixing of all can be done manually using a whisk. 
  • I used mixer as it will be very easy and can be done quickly.
